What is Avis Budget Group's europe, middle east and africa — total lease revenues?
Avis Budget Group (CAR) reported europe, middle east and africa — total lease revenues of $506.25M in Q4 2025.
How has Avis Budget Group's europe, middle east and africa — total lease revenues changed year-over-year?
Avis Budget Group's europe, middle east and africa — total lease revenues increased by 3.4% year-over-year, from $489.5M to $506.25M.
What is the long-term trend for Avis Budget Group's europe, middle east and africa — total lease revenues?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Avis Budget Group's europe, middle east and africa — total lease revenues has grown at a 10.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$1.34B to $2.03B.
What does europe, middle east and africa — total lease revenues mean?
This metric measures the specific revenue derived from the core vehicle rental and leasing operations within the Europe, Middle East, and Africa segment. It excludes non-rental ancillary income to isolate the performance of the primary fleet-based business model. Tracking this metric allows investors to assess the operational efficiency and pricing power of the company's core rental services in this specific geographic territory.
